Meskipun saling menolong adalah kewajiban moral, ada etika yang perlu diperhatikan. Sebuah artikel dengan jelas menyebutkan bahwa kita tidak boleh terlalu sering meminta bantuan hingga merepotkan dan menyusahkan teman. Hal-hal seperti meminta ditemani kemana-mana, meminta solusi untuk setiap masalah, terlalu sering meminjam uang tanpa mengembalikan, atau hampir setiap hari numpang tidur dan makan di rumah teman, adalah perilaku yang perlu dihindari. Pertolongan harus didasarkan pada kemampuan masing-masing dan tidak membuat salah satu pihak merasa dieksploitasi.

By embracing the spirit of mutual help, individuals strengthen the very fabric of their social circles. When friends support one another, they create a positive and harmonious environment where everyone feels safe and valued. This dynamic reduces the potential for conflict and builds a resilient "support system" that can weather the challenges of life together, from minor daily stresses to major life crises. In a broader sense, this culture of helping binds communities together, fostering a sense of belonging and collective well-being. One of the most powerful aspects of this principle is its call for inclusivity. True "tolong-menolong" should be extended to all friends and acquaintances without discrimination. As highlighted in a study on Islamic teachings, offering help should not be limited to one's own circle of close friends or family members and should not be influenced by differences in ethnicity, race, or religion. In a diverse society, this all-encompassing approach is what builds truly strong and unified communities, as it reinforces the idea that we are all interconnected.
